BlackRock and Ark Invest Expand BMNR Holdings Significantly
BitMine Immersion Technologies (NYSE: BMNR) has recently caught the attention of major institutional investors, particularly BlackRock, which disclosed a staggering 165% increase in its holdings. This substantial acquisition also follows an impressive $4.2 million purchase of BMNR shares by Cathie Wood’s Ark Invest. Such developments are making waves in the investment community, showcasing the growing interest in cryptocurrency and blockchain technologies.
The Institutional Buying Surge
Recent filings reveal that BlackRock's ownership in BitMine skyrocketed from 3.4 million shares to an impressive 9 million shares, valued at approximately $245.7 million. This adjustment reflects a strategic decision by the asset manager, even as BitMine grapples with significant unrealized losses due to the volatility of Ethereum. This resilience in investment strategy raises questions about the long-term outlook for both BlackRock and BitMine.
Meanwhile, Cathie Wood’s Ark Invest has also diversified its exposure to cryptocurrencies by purchasing 212,314 additional shares of BMNR across three exchange-traded funds (ETFs) last Thursday. This move comes during a phase wherein BMNR's stock price has seen a notable decline of 36.7% in the past month, revealing a bold stance to enhance crypto investments amid fluctuating market conditions.
Significant Ethereum Holdings
In an impressive show of growth, BitMine has recently added 40,613 Ethereum (ETH) to its portfolio, indicating an aggressive accumulation strategy. As of a recent report, BitMine holds a total of 4,325,738 ETH, which is around 3.58% of the total ETH supply, valued at $2,125 each. These figures indicate that BitMine remains a significant player in the Ethereum space, contributing to its ongoing market relevance despite current challenges.
Tom Lee, the Chairman of BitMine, has attributed some of the recent underperformance of Ethereum to external factors rather than fundamental weaknesses within the cryptocurrency itself. He notes that the lack of leverage in the market following October's dramatic downturn has affected investor sentiment, raising concerns about the appetite for riskier assets such as cryptocurrencies.
